Output 161c6a44b1c4d07e857581dd955f198e34c29231ccafd5e37cd1097b4259f80f:1

value
379209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13c608f4e72849871e2e3b4502d8d44536277486 OP_EQUAL
address
33VZzuC2idp6TBsorUYVrGo92NwXsM6EaB
transaction
161c6a44b1c4d07e857581dd955f198e34c29231ccafd5e37cd1097b4259f80f
confirmations
158117
spent
true